Description:

The Mechanical Engineer will be a key member of the team overseeing the mechanical aspects of the construction of a new power generation plant. This role involves designing, planning, and inspecting mechanical systems and components such as turbines, boilers, pumps, and heat exchangers. The engineer will collaborate with multidisciplinary teams to ensure seamless integration of mechanical systems with other plant operations. Their work focuses on ensuring the reliability, efficiency, and safety of the plant's mechanical infrastructure, contributing to the overall success of the project.

Responsibilities:

Create detailed plans and designs for the plant's mechanical systems, including turbines, boilers, heat exchangers, pumps, and other mechanical equipment. Ensure all mechanical designs and installations adhere to safety standards and regulations, conducting risk assessments and implementing safety protocols as needed. Conduct inspections and tests of mechanical systems and equipment throughout the construction process to ensure compliance with specifications and quality standards. Oversee the mechanical aspects of the construction project, coordinating with other engineers, contractors, and project managers to meet deadlines and budget constraints. Address and resolve any mechanical issues that arise during construction, optimizing system performance and identifying opportunities for improvement. Maintain accurate records of mechanical designs, inspections, test results, and modifications. Prepare reports on the performance, quality, and reliability of mechanical systems for project stakeholders. Work closely with electrical, civil, and control systems engineers to ensure cohesive integration and functionality of all plant systems. Assist in the selection of mechanical materials and equipment, and work with procurement teams to ensure timely delivery and quality standards are met. Participate in the commissioning process of mechanical systems to ensure they are installed and functioning according to specifications. Assist with the handover to the operational team. Ensure the mechanical components and systems meet the required quality standards, and recommend improvements as needed. Explore opportunities for innovative solutions and improvements in mechanical systems to enhance the plant's efficiency and performance. Provide guidance and training to junior engineers and team members on mechanical systems and safety practices.
